Class: Devise::Oauth2::AuthorizationsController

Inherits:
ApplicationController
  • Object
show all
Includes:
Authorization
Defined in:
app/controllers/devise/oauth2/authorizations_controller.rb

Instance Method Summary collapse

Methods included from Authorization

#access_token, #access_token?, #access_token_signed_in?, #auth_code, #authenticate_anyone!, #client_credentials, #client_credentials?, #client_id, #client_id?, #client_secret, #client_secret?, #code?, #current_access_token, #current_anything, #current_oauth2_client, #devise_scope_name, #oauth2_client_signed_in?, #refresh_token, #refresh_token?, #valid_access_token?

Instance Method Details

#createObject



20
21
22
# File 'app/controllers/devise/oauth2/authorizations_controller.rb', line 20

def create
  authorize_endpoint(:allow_approval)
end

#newObject



16
17
18
# File 'app/controllers/devise/oauth2/authorizations_controller.rb', line 16

def new
  authorize_endpoint
end